Estes Park is moderately more affordable than Black Forest, with a 8.4% lower cost of living index. Black Forest scores 140 compared to 129 for Estes Park, where the US average is 100. This difference means residents of Black Forest can expect to pay noticeably more for everyday expenses, housing, and services.

When it comes to buying, median home values in Black Forest are $805,200 compared to $634,200 in Estes Park, a 27% gap.

Median household income in Black Forest is $142,173 compared to $73,313 in Estes Park (+93.9%). While Black Forest is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income.
